
TextCube를 설치했다.
TextCube는 기존의 BlogTool인 TatterTools가 버전업을 하면서 개명(?)했다고 생각하면 된다. (물론 만든 사람들은 더 많은 의미를 주장하지만. )
현재 최종 안정판인 1.6.3을 설치했다.
이번에 설치하면서 알았는데 의외로 TextCube도 버그가 많다는 거였다.
먼거 가장 눈에 띄었던건 서비스 도메인에 대한 오류였다. 이 티켓과 관련이 있어보이는데, http://blog.xxx.com 에 설치를 할경우 host를 제외한 domain만 가져와 인식하게 되어있어서 congif.php에 서비스도메인이 blog.xxx.com 이 아닌 xxx.com으로 설정되는 문제가 있다.
host가 www일때는 문제가 없겠지만, 나처럼 별도의 서버에 별도의 서브도메인으로 운영하려고 하면 setup이 종료된후, config.php를 열어서 수정을 해주어야 한다.
또한 이번버전업에 'IIS에 대한 지원이 강화되었다.'란 내용이 있음에도 불구하고, 실제로 설치가 되진 않았다. 이건 환경의 특성탓일 수도 있기때문에 버그라하긴 뭐하지만, 어쨌든, PHP Setup for IIS 하에선 설치되지 않았다.
문제가 된건 서버쪽 환경변수가 TextCube의 소스와 PHP Setup for IIS 에서 제공하는 환경이 달라서 파일위치, 도메인, 등을 잘 불러오지 못했다.
처리된 티켓이 있기는 한데, 이게 다가 아닌건지, PHP를 IIS에 붙여서 사용할때 버전이나 모듈에 따라 케이스가 다른건지는 PHP개발자가 아니라서 잘 모르겠다.
어쨌든 이때문에 IIS는 포기하고 Apache로 변경.
Windows+APM위에서 도메인 인식문제만 해결하고 나니 아주 가볍게 세팅 끝.
근데 직원들이 사용을 해야 할텐데.. ㅡ ㅡ
참고로 친절하게 windows에 APM설치부터 설명된곳이 있다. 참고

